The evening will also offer plenty of networking ... WebQualifying Engineering Experience In order to constitute qualifying experience, the experience must meet a number of criteria. First, the experience should be from a major branch of engineering in which the candidate claims proficiency. Second, the experience must be supervised.

A bachelor’s degree in engineering from an ETAC ... to which equation does the graph representWebProfessional Engineer Licensure Available in California: There are three categories of Professional Engineer licensure available in California: (1) practice act, (2) title act, and (3) title authority. The practice acts are Civil, Electrical, and Mechanical Engineering.
